A weekly chat about women's health from an expert in the fields of restorative endocrinology, functional neurology and functional medicine. The podcast will feature patient stories, health advice and Dr. Lovely's own special take on mind, body and spiritual healing for women of all ages and stages. Find out more at drlovely.expert.
